It is necessary to preserve and promote the cultural values of the Thai people.
(Baonghean.vn) -That was the issue emphasized at the 8th National Conference on Thai Studies held in Con Cuong, Nghe An. This is alsois a rare opportunity for scientists and Thai culture lovers to discuss the Thai community and the Tay - Thai language family.
Attending the conference were comrades: Phan Van Hung - Deputy Minister, Vice Chairman of the Ethnic Committee; Le Minh Thong - Member of the Provincial Party Committee, Vice Chairman of Nghe An Provincial People's Committee.
The National Conference on Thai Hoc Vietnam took place on June 24 and 25 in Con Cuong district - Nghe An. The issues of forest protection, water resources, creating livelihoods for ethnic minority people, developing community tourism... are topics of interest at the 8th National Conference on Thai Hoc Vietnam.

The National Conference on Thai Studies is held every two years by the Vietnam Thai Studies Program. This program was founded in 1989 and is affiliated with the Institute of Vietnamese Studies and Development Sciences with the role of researching the Thai community and the Kadai group including ethnic groups of the same Tay - Thai language family such as: Tay Nung, Pu Péo, Giay, Lu... The theme of this Conference is "Promoting the role of the identity of the Thai - Kadai ethnic community in integration and sustainable development.

There were 25 presentations by leading ethnologists and non-specialists nationwide in many fields discussing the communities of the Thai, Tay, Nung, Lu, Pu Peo ethnic groups... including issues of concern such as indigenous knowledge in preserving forests and water resources. The integration of resettled communities under the Son La Hydropower Plant...
The presentations also focused on issues such as community tourism development, preserving national cultural identity, the contribution of clan chiefs to the development of mountainous society, and the creation of livelihoods for people through crop rotation practices.

Nghe An delegation had 7 presentations at the conference. The presentations focused on issues such as community tourism development, the current situation and issues in the use of natural resources, and creating livelihoods from intercropping and shifting cultivation practices of the Thai community.
Speaking at the conference, Mr. Le Minh Thong - Vice Chairman of Nghe An Provincial People's Committee said: The Thai people in Nghe An currently have about 324,000 people, this is an ethnic minority community with diverse and rich cultural characteristics. The Thai people are also a community with the ability to breathe new life into nature. That ability is thanks to the rich history and culture of this community. Therefore, the preservation and promotion of the cultural values of the Thai people must always be promoted, contributing to enriching the diversity of Vietnamese ethnic culture./.
